Eye colour variation in primates October 15, 2022 NUS researchers propose that the causes of eye colour variation in primates may, in part, be explained by differences in lighting in the habitats of primate species.

Among tamarins and spider monkeys, all males are dichromats-they can't perceive reds or greens. But females split 60. Apes and Old World monkeys also have trichromatic vision, but New World monkeys have variable color vision that is also sex-linked, meaning that males and females of the same species can have different color vision.
